"quarrelled" in Chinese (Simplified)
争吵吵架
Definition
指激烈地争吵,通常是用言语而非肢体的争执。常用于家人或朋友之间的不和。
Usage Notes (Chinese (Simplified))
比 'argued' 更正式、更书面,常见于英式英语和文学,用于私人关系的争吵,不适用于正式辩论。常与“with (某人)”搭配。
